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 | 31 |
Tags
- 하둡
- 몽고디비 렘
- http 개념
- 자바 디자인 패턴
- 우분투
- 자바
- 백준
- 백준 사이트
- 12761 돌다리
- 백준 12761
- golang struct
- ddd
- go
- 백준 파이썬
- 도메인 주도 개발
- hadoop
- 정렬
- MongoDB Realm
- golang
- 트리 순회
- 도메인 주도 개발 시작하기
- 파이썬
- domain driven develop
- 12761번 돌다리
- 고 배열
- http 완벽가이드
- 백준 12761번
- flask
- 자바 디자인패턴
- String 함수
Archives
- Today
- Total
개발바닥
큐 본문
반응형
큐(Queue)란?
스택과 마찬가지로 데이터를 일시적으로 쌓아 두기 위한 자료구조이다.
큐는 선입선출(FIFO)구조로 먼저 들어 온것이 먼저 나가는 방식이다.
큐에 데이터를 넣는 작업을 인큐(enqueue)라 하고, 데이터를 꺼내는 작업을 디큐(dequeue)라고 한다.
데이터를 꺼내는 쪽을 프런트(front)라 하고, 데이터를 넣는 쪽을 리어(rear)라고 한다.
아래 그림에서 보듯이 스택이 엎어져있다고 생각하시면 됩니다.
자바로 원형 큐 구현 소스
https://github.com/jokerKwu/java/blob/master/JavaStructure/src/Queue.java
반응형
Comments